Abstract

Computational reactor simulation tool offers new possibilities for analysing and enhancing the performance of existing and new reactors. Therefore a reactor simulation tool, called ReST, was developed using a tanks in series model. ReST allows representing real life, complex issues like by-pass, back flow, dead space and backmixing in gas and liquid phases etc. via easy to use menus. This makes it a very versatile and flexible reactor simulation tool. A case study of chlorination of acetic acid is presented to illustrate the usage of ReST.
